A leading developer of CAD/CAM software solutions worldwide, OPEN MIND Technologies, has announced it has recently partnered with Okuma America Corporation, joining the Partners in THINC collaboration, founded by Okuma.

OPEN MIND's strong focus on CAM, and its continued commitment to the latest technologies, produces trend setting innovations that make it significantly easier for customers to achieve substantial quality, time and cost improvements. OPEN MIND's hyperMILL software is a CAM solution with 2.5D, 3D, five axis milling and turning strategies, as well as specialty applications, that are all available in one interface.

Alan Levine, Managing Director for OPEN MIND Technologies, stated: "We are looking forward to collaborating with Okuma and the members of Partners in THINC to bring the most advanced, integrated solutions to manufacturers. As we continually strive to keep our CAD/CAM solutions at the forefront of the industry, we welcome the opportunity to work together with other leading companies to enable customers to leverage our technology to meet and exceed their production needs."

Wade Anderson, Director, Partners in THINC, added: "We are extremely pleased to welcome OPEN MIND to Partners in THINC. OPEN MIND's globally recognised, powerful five axis and multifunction CAD/CAM solutions will strengthen and expand our technology portfolio to address the needs of the expanding additive manufacturing segment and much more."

Okuma and OPEN MIND collaborate on four axis and five axis projects for various Okuma machines including machining centres, multi-function mill-turn machines and hybrid technology, resulting in significant improvements in precision, reliability and quality for increased customer productivity.

Partners in THINC is a collaboration network of more than 40 industry leaders who come together to solve problems and explore new productivity ideas for real-world manufacturing. With the open architecture, PC-based OSP control as its nucleus, Partners in THINC brings specialised equipment, expertise and a commitment to provide the best possible integrated solutions to the end-user.
